Melancon pressing Dem leaders to allow drilling ban vote

By Ben Geman - 07/29/10 03:25 PM ET

Rep. Charlie Melancon (D-La.) said he is negotiating with House Democratic leadership about allowing a vote Friday on his amendment to lift or scale back the Obama administration’s six-month ban on deepwater oil-and-gas drilling.

Melancon and other Gulf Coast lawmakers say the drilling freeze — imposed in the wake of the BP spill — is piling more economic pain on the already-battered region. He wants to amend the Democratic spill response bill expected on the House floor Friday.

“They [Democratic leaders] are working with me. They understand, of course, as you know, in my caucus there is going to be opposition to anything that encourages offshore [drilling]. So, I am trying to allay those fears and ... find a balance but still give me the ability to go home and keep an industry alive that is real important to us,” Melancon told The Hill on Thursday.

House Speaker Nancy Pelosi’s (D-Calif.) office could not be reached for comment.

Melancon said the discussions are about “getting a vote on a moratorium amendment and trying to allay whatever concerns they may have.”

“I want to be able to hopefully be successful. This isn’t just a Don Quixote episode. This is about something that is very important to us,” he said. Melancon said there are ways to ease the ban while ensuring safeguards are met.

One option, he said, is using “rotating” inspections to allow rigs under contract to proceed with drilling after their check-up.

Melancon also suggested allowing rigs to drill through layers of rock while stopping 1,000 feet before they reach oil-and-gas reservoirs “just to make sure everything is on the up and up.”

“We keep the rigs drilling and we keep the people working and we don’t jeopardize the safety of the Gulf or the people that are on those rigs,” he said.
